The most effective supplements for aiding with muscle growth, recovery, and repair work are those that contain the three important branched-chain amino acids (BCAAs) valine, leucine, and isoleucine. The BCAAs are very important to muscle metabolic process and make up roughly 15% of the amino acid content in human skeletal muscle mass. Among the essential benefits of BCAAs is that they aid mitochondria in energy production throughout workout, aiding to stop both psychological and physical fatigue throughout exercise. This makes BCAAs additionally a prominent pre-workout component along with post-workout.

Sufficient protein in the diet regimen is required to provide the EAAs necessary for muscle-protein synthesis and to decrease muscle-protein break down. Dietary protein intake increases the focus of amino acids in the blood, which muscle mass cells then occupy. Adequate protein is needed primarily to maximize the training response to, and the recuperation duration after, exercise [12,157]

Beta-alanine is produced in the liver, and relatively small amounts are present in animal-based foods such as meat, poultry, and fish. Estimated nutritional consumption range from none in vegans to regarding 1 g/day in hefty meat eaters [52] Carnosine exists in animal-based foods, such as beef and pork. Nonetheless, oral usage of carnosine is an ineffective method of boosting muscle mass carnosine focus due to the fact that the dipeptide is digested right into its component amino acids. Consumption of beta-alanine, in contrast, accurately raises the quantity of carnosine in the body.

Although 30 of the 33 trials revealed favorable enhancements in efficiency, the improvements were not statistically considerable in half of them [85] In these research studies, efficiency renovation ranged from a reduction of 0.7% to a boost of 17.3%, recommending that the caffeine was really handy to some participants but slightly impaired efficiency in others. Aspects such as the timing of intake, caffeine consumption mode or form, and habituation to caffeine could additionally have actually accounted for the varied impacts on performance.
